Jahaj kothi, Hisar
The sculpture represents an unknown deity positioned on a pillar, showcasing several distinctive characteristics. Notably, the figure is depicted in a tribhanga posture, with her left hand raised in abhaymudra, while she adorns a bajubandh on her arm. The right hand, however, is damaged. The deity stands upon a pedestal and is adorned with a simple bead necklace around her neck.
